Cable Specification: Cable Mines and Quarries to BS5467 and BC295. The cable features plain annealed stranded copper conductors, XLPE insulated, PVC extruded bedding, galvanised steel wire armour incorporating tinned copper wires to provide 60% conductivity of any one phase, PVC outer sheath.

Application Overview: Cleveland Cable Company stocks a range of (3300V) Mine and quarry cable. This mining cable is generally used in coal fields and quarries and features extra copper in the steel wire armour which improves its conductivity to 60% in any one phase. Sheath Resistance testing is a key onsite diagnostic test for identifying potential cable faults. Commonly known as a Megger Test, it uses a Megohmmeter to measure the resistance of the crosslinked or thermoplastic compound to an applied DC voltage.

sheathing forms the cable, wrapping around the insulated black, white and/or red wires and the uninsulated ground wire, if there is one. The sheathing is what you can see and touch, typically in the unfinished areas of homes and garages. Older wires have cloth or paper sheathing. Newer wires have plastic sheathing.
Before about 2001, most NM cable had a white outer jacket, but since 2001, most NMB cable has been jacketed with a vinyl outer insulation that is colored to identify it for both consumers and inspectors. This color coding of the wire sheath is strictly voluntary, but most manufacturers have now followed suit in adhering to the color scheme.
